Chandigarh murder case: After Manimajra triple murder case, another crime has rocked the town when a man killed his wife in the early hours on Tuesday. The incident took place at Mariwala town. The accused has been identified as Jarnail Singh who killed his wife Manjit Kaur with an axe. An FIR under section 302 of the IPC has been registered on the complaint of Sajjan Singh against Jarnail Singh. The complainant stated that Jarnail Singh was living with his wife Manjeet Kaur along with daughter Sneha and son Sukhpreet Singh. The accused Jarnail Singh was alcoholic and due to this he often scuffled with his wife Manjeet Kaur. Manjeet was domestic servant and the only bread earner for her children. On Tuesday, his niece Sneha came out from her house with loudly voice, after which Sajjan ran into the house of accused Jarnail Singh and he saw that his accused carry the Axe in his hand and assaulting his wife with the Axe. After seeing him, he ran away from the spot, after that there neighbour Sonia Choudhary called police. Upron receiving information, the police reached the spot and rushed the injured lady to PGI, where doctor declared Manjeet Kaur dead. https://www.facebook.com/ptcnewsonline/videos/135766100880681/?t=1 During the course of investigation, accused Jarnail Singh was arrested on Thursday. The accused was being produced in Hon’ble court to obtain 2 days police remand for further interrogation in present case. Earlier, a man murdered his wife and two kids at Modern Housing Complex, in Manimajra. The accused was identified as Sanjay Arora, who later tried to commited suicide after the crime. https://www.ptcnews.tv/chandigarh-child-murder-case-mother-killed-her-son-and-daughter-en/ It was the third incident of murder in Chandigarh. Recently, a woman killed her two-and-a-half-year-old son by stuffing a glove in his mouth at a house in Burail, Sector 45, on January 26. The accused woman has been identified as Roopa. During the preliminary investigation, the police observed that Roopa had also killed her 6-month-old daughter in December. The probe also revealed that the victim had died after her neck bone was broken. -PTC News
